THE REGIONAL WEATHER FORECAST
FOR TOMORROW 2021-02-04
ISSUED AT 1600 SAST
BY THE SOUTH AFRICAN WEATHER SERVICE. THIS FORECAST WILL BE UPDATED AT 0500 SAST.
SEVERE WEATHER ALERTS
IMPACT-BASED
WARNINGS
1. Yellow (Level 2) Warning Disruptive rainfall that may lead to localised flooding of susceptible formal/informal settlements or roads, low-lying areas and bridges, major roads affected but can be used, increased travel times, difficult driving conditions on dirt roads with closure of roads crossing low water bridges, localised damage to mud-based/make-shift houses/structures, localised mudslides, as well as rockfalls is expected in Gauteng, the eastern parts of the North-West Province, northern parts of the Free State, Highveld and escarpment areas of Mpumalanga and southern parts of Limpopo. FIRE DANGER
WARNINGS
–1. Extremely high fire danger conditions are expected over the central parts of the Northern Cape. ADVISORIES Nil.
PROVINCIAL WEATHER OVERVIEW
GAUTENG PROVINCE
Warm in the north, otherwise cloudy and cool with scattered showers and thundershowers. The expected UVB sunburn Index Moderate
MPUMALANGA PROVINCE
Partly cloudy and cool to warm with scattered showers and thundershowers but isolated in the Lowveld where it will be hot.
LIMPOPO PROVINCE
Partly cloudy and warm with scattered showers and thundershowers but isolated in the north.
NORTH-WEST PROVINCE
Cloudy and cool to warm with widespread showers and rain but scattered in the extreme western parts.
FREE STATE
Fine in the south, otherwise cloudy and cool to warm with isolated showers and thundershowers but scattered in the north.
NORTHERN CAPE
Cool along the coast with morning fog patches, otherwise fine and warm to hot but cloudy in the east with isolated showers and thundershowers. The wind along the coast will be moderate southerly to southeasterly but fresh to strong in the afternoon.
WESTERN CAPE
Partly cloudy along the south coast and eastern interior in the morning, otherwise fine and warm to hot but very hot in places over the interior and west coast. It will become cloudy along the south coast towards the evening. The wind along the coast will be light and variable along the south coast at first, otherwise moderate to fresh southerly to southeasterly, becoming strong along the west coast from the afternoon. The expected UVB sunburn Index Extreme.
WESTERN HALF OF THE EASTERN CAPE
Hot in the north, otherwise partly cloudy and warm. The wind along the coast will be light south westerly to southerly, becoming moderate southeasterly to easterly from the afternoon.
EASTERN HALF OF THE EASTERN CAPE
Morning fog along the escarpment, otherwise partly cloudy and warm, becoming cloudy in the south from the afternoon with rain along the coast. Isolated afternoon showers and thundershowers are expected in the north. The wind along the coast will be moderate to fresh southwesterly, becoming moderate southeasterly from the afternoon.
KWAZULU-NATAL
Morning fog patches over the northern interior, otherwise partly cloudy and warm but hot in places in the north. Isolated afternoon showers and thundershowers are expected over the interior. The wind along the coast will be light northeasterly at first, otherwise easterly to southeasterly, but moderate southwesterly in the south. The expected UVB sunburn Index High.
